 | | Remembering Mark Langford |
| Mark died last year, unfortunately we have only just been told of the sad news. Paul Southworth contacted us with the details.
With great regret I am belatedly letting you know of the death of Mark Langford, ex-Dial House Exchange Construction and latterly Openreach, who died on May 9th 2024.
Mark was a lovely bloke, fiercely loyal to his family and friends, quiet, and yet would not spare his opinion about something he felt was wrong, and he was also a VERY fine guitarist a massive fan of Frank Zappa, which probably gives you an idea of how good a guitarist Mark was, keen cyclist, and enthusiastic allotment-holder.
Mark followed his dad, Frank, into 'Post Office Telecommunications' in Dial House, where they both simultaneously worked for a time. Towards the end of his career Mark got moved into Openreach, which he quite honestly couldn't stand, so he took release aged around 49 and enjoyed the rest of his days cycling, sharing possibly four, I think, allotments with a friend, and playing guitar.
Mark Langford
September 8th 1961 - May 9th 2024
Mark's funeral was on 16th July 2024. |
